Objective Summary of Splenectomy on treatment of refractory IdiopathicThrombocytopenic Purpura: therapeutic effect and influence factors of, look for preoperativeprediction of therapeutic effects of Splenectomy. Methods Retrospective analysis of clinical dataof 15 years of hospital splenectomy in treatment of refractory ITP patients (62 cases); age,gender, and whether the preoperative bleeding, preoperative response to hormones, spleenenlargement, surgery the relationship between the platelet peak and splenectomy therapy.Results In 62 cases, effective in 34 cases, good effect in 13 cases, 10 cases improved, 5 cases areinvalid; efficiency (show good effect for 75.8% +).Gender and spleen enlargement withsplenectomy curative effect is independent of the grouping factors, no significant differencebetween; bleeding symptoms, age, postoperative platelet peak, bone marrow megakaryocytefactors between groups difference has statistics significance; multiple factor analysis show that,the preoperative responses to hormones and preoperative platelet count spleen resection efficacyis the main influence factor; the two there is a significant difference between the index group (P< 0.005).Conclusion Preoperative hormone response and preoperative platelet count withclinical use should be the value can be used as a predictor of the efficacy of splenectomy.
